The Ortega R122-1/4-L is a concert guitar in 1/4 format, which makes it the ideal choice for children aged around 5 to 7 years or for players with a height of around 110 to 130 cm. The compact scale length of 438 mm makes it easier to grip and promotes playing technique in the long term. This model is a real stroke of luck for left-handers in particular, as it is specially designed to meet their ergonomic requirements.
A highlight of this guitar is the solid cedar top, which gives the sound a warm, full characteristic - ideal for classical pieces or plucked playing. Cedar is known for its quick response and richness of sound, even with a light touch, which makes it particularly attractive for younger players. The back and sides are made of mahogany, a tonewood prized for its balanced timbre and robustness.
The neck is also made of mahogany and has a matt finish, which provides a pleasant playing feel. The fingerboard and bridge are made of Sonokelin - a durable, stable-sounding wood with good playability and an attractive appearance. With 18 frets, the guitar offers sufficient musical scope for first melodies, chords and classical etudes.
The nut width is 43.5 mm - a standard size that adapts well to small hands without making playing difficult. Particularly noteworthy is the Ortega 12-hole bridge, which not only ensures improved string action, but also optimizes the transmission of vibrations to the top - a detail that is directly noticeable in the sound.
